Fire Thermal Camera . Thermal imagers can provide first responders with critical information to size up a fire incident, track fire growth, and locate victims, other first responders, and egress routes. They have been credited with saving multiple lives every year.

Thermal imaging cameras allow firefighters to see through darkness or smoke so they can locate and rescue victims faster. Obviously, the fire itself is easy to see in a thermal imager, but the relatively cold water being sprayed from the hoses also shows up clearly on a thermal image, so firefighters can make sure they get water on the fire.
